#59dffd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59dffd is composed of 34.9% red, 87.5%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.8% cyan, 11.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 191 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 67.1%. #59dffd color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ffff with #00bffb.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#59dffd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#59dffd has RGB values of R:89, G:223,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 5890045.

Shades and Tints of #59dffd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000708 is the darkest color, while #f4fdff is the lightest one.
